Dividend Yield Range

The Dividend Yield Range is the range of values in which a stock’s dividend yield has fluctuated within a specified period, often a year. It represents the variation between the highest and lowest dividend yields observed during that time frame.

ABOUT PUTNAM HIGH INCOME BOND FUND
High Income Securities Fund is a closed-ended balanced income mutual fund launched and managed by Putnam Investment Management, LLC. The fund is co-managed by Putnam Investments Limited. It invests in the fixed income markets of the United States. The fund seeks to invest in st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ors.
